Chora - Surajgarha, Lakhisarai
Chora is a village situated in the Surajgarha subdivision of Lakhisarai district, Bihar. It is located approximately 24 km from the tehsil headquarters in Surajgarha and around 36 km from the district headquarters in Lakhisarai. Chora-rajpur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Chora village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Chora is 243470. The village covers a total geographical area of 740.6 hectares and falls under the 811112 pincode. Lakhisarai is the nearest town, located about 36 km away.
Chora village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Mukhiya serving as the elected head.
Population of Chora
According to the 2011 Census, Chora village had a total population of 3,669 people, including 1,889 males and 1,780 females, living in 695 households. The sex ratio was 942 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 38.56%, with male literacy at 47.18% and female literacy at 29.22%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 10, while the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 1,810.
The table below presents a detailed demographic breakdown of the village, including separate male and female figures for each population category.
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 3,669 | 1,889 | 1,780 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 733 | 363 | 370 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 10 | 4 | 6 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 1,810 | 931 | 879 |
| Literate Population | 1,132 | 720 | 412 |
| Illiterate Population | 2,537 | 1,169 | 1,368 |

Transport and Connectivity of Chora
Chora is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is located within 5-10 km of Chora.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Railway Station | No | Available within 5-10 km |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Lakhisarai to Chora is about 36 km, with a usual travel time of around 1-1.25 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.

Health Facilities in Chora
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Chora village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| No | Available within >10 km |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
